The Department of Cellular and Molecular Pharmacology is an integral and essential part of the Rosalind Franklin University of Medicine and Science.  Our mission is discovery, scholarship and service.  Pharmacology forms the basis for much of modern medicine and is the preferred mode of intervention in many diseases.  The processes underlying drug actions and drug discovery are fundamentally multidisciplinary, intersecting fields as diverse as physiology, anatomy, behavioral neuroscience, biochemistry and molecular biology.  This department carries out research in all these areas and is committed to preparing students for careers in pharmacological and medical research and service.  We contribute to academic teaching by providing a solid foundation in pharmacology and therapeutics for medical, podiatry and physician's assistant students and also in neuropharmacology for graduate students.  For more detailed information regarding the research and publications of faculty, staff, and students in our department, please read our department annual report for the 2007 calendar year.  If you would like more information about our graduate program or any other aspect of our department, please do not hesitate to contact me at gloria.meredith@rosalindfranklin.edu
